Chapter 117: A Sister's Secret

Her tawny brown hair is matted and hasn't been washed for weeks. She looks different from how I left her. When Chase said Ruby meant nothing to him, I didn't know this is what I would find. A slave.

"Ruby."

She averts her gaze and wipes the spot underneath her eyes with her finger. I see the way she tightens her hold on the basket in her hand.

I ask. "What happened to you, Ruby?"

"Chase Erickson happened." She smiles ruefully.

I know I've heard those words before. Zeke had said them to me when I woke up at the hospital, and he carried me home. I pause for a moment because thoughts about him always make me feel things I shouldn't feel. I hate him. I remind myself that.

"Can we talk?"

She eyes my clean clothes and hair and snarls. "Why? Did you come here to gloat, Mare? I see that bastard is finally treating you right."

"Ruby, don't say that. We have a lot to talk about. You're still my sister."

"But are you still mine?"

My lips quiver in hurt. "At least invite me in."
